G'day All Just a quick enquiry regarding what to look for in relation to the correct engine for vehicle. Im looking at buying a 1968 Formal roof Gt Torino with claimed S code 390 here in Aussie and need to know where to look for the engine code, cylinder head casting numbers and how to decipher without tearing down the Donk. I know that the regular members here would have been asked this question a thousand times so apoligies in advance for being a pest but I do want to make sure Im buying the genuine thing. K not sure how big an answer you want but if you still need info Try getting your hands on a little booklet called.Ford High Performance Parts Identifier. author Robert m Winkelman and distributed by sunset mustang.
